C. 2011-12 Kenton County School District Gifted Student Population Enc. 5
The Kenton County School District Gifted Education Program identification process for the 2011-12 school
year has been completed and entered into Infinite Campus as official documentation for all identified students
in our school district. The information is required by the Kentucky Department of Education and will be used
for state data collection in May 2012. The chart identifies each school and the percent of students identified in
the PTP (Primary Talent Pool) for grades kindergarten through third and the percent of students in all
categories of formal identification that take place in grades four through twelve. Once students are identified
formally in any grade, their identification continues until high school graduation. Multiple gifted services are
provided to identified students.
The PTP (Primary Talent Pool) is an informal identification of students in grades kindergarten through three (P1- P4) who show potential for high ability learning. Parents are notified in writing at the beginning of each school
year of the student’s identification. Parents of Primary Talent Pool students are given a plan listing the teaching
service options used with the student to meet their needs, interests and abilities.
Parents/guardians of students formally identified gifted in one or more area are notified in writing at the beginning of each school year listing all areas of identification. Once each semester a (GSSP) Gifted Student Service Plan
is reported to the parent/guardian providing information on multiple teaching service options being used to meet
the needs, interests and abilities of his/her student. Parent Feedback Forms are sent home with the GSSP to
receive parent input and to address any questions.
An evaluation of the district gifted program determines comprehensive identification for PTP and all formal gifted areas. Identified students are provided multiple gifted service options. Professional development, planning and
teaching to increase differentiated instruction, grouping options and meeting the social and emotional needs of the
gifted student population is a continuous district goal.

3. Board Depository – FY 2013 and 2014
Proposals for banking and depository services were received on April 18, 2012. The enclosure
demonstrates the results of these proposals. Based on these results, it is recommended that First
Financial Bank be approved as the Board’s depository for FY 2013 and 2014. Finance staff has
met with the First Financial officials to ensure that all service requirements can be met. The
interest rate quoted for the next two years on transactional accounts will be the Fed Funds rate
(currently .25%) minus .20%. Each proposal was analyzed to determine the best net result to the
district. Since the rate is indexed, if rates increase, the district interest earnings will increase
correspondingly. In addition, First Financial will provide at no cost, a daily courier service for each
school and cafeteria, eliminating mileage costs and employee downtime. Schools will also qualify
for no fee checking accounts. Rate have become so compressed that we will continue to find
alternatives to increase investment income as opposed relying daily balances. Federal agency
securities will be utilized to achieve a higher rate of return than is offered on our depository
proposals.

3. Section Seven School Allocations – KAR 3:246
Section 7 of KAR 3:246 School Council Allocation Formula provides that if there are funds available to be
distributed after council allocations are budgeted and general operating expenses are met, that those funds
may be distributed in the following ways;
(a) An amount per pupil based on prior year average daily attendance (b) Based on pupil needs identified by school councils in their adopted school improvement plans and
designated by the local board
(c) For specific instructional purposes based on student needs identified by the board from disaggregated student achievement data
(d) A combination of (a), (b), and (c) above.
The section seven allocations presented for approval are those indicated by the schools’ improvement
plans, enrollment adjustments, and budget requests. Some adjustments have been made to the Section
Seven allocations as a result of the recommendations made by the Budget Committee.
At the High Schools, 1 position for SWS/ISS was eliminated at each school. The classified positions are the
